The Punjab Registration Validating Act, 1960
Punjab Act 8 of 1960

Received the assent of the Governor of Punjab on the 24th January, 1960, and was first published in the Punjab Government Gazette Extraordinary, dated the 28th January, 1960.
An act to validate certain registration and matters appurtenant thereto.
Be it enacted by the legislature of the State of Punjab in the Eleventh Year of the Republic of India as follows :-
- Short title and commencement.- This Act may be called the Punjab Registration Validation Act, 1960.
- Validation of acts of registering officer purporting to act as Sub- Registrar and Registrar.- All acts performed by the -
(a) registering officers specified in column 2 of the Schedule purporting to act as Registrars of the district specified in column 1 thereof during the periods noted against each in column 3 of that Schedule; and
(b) Sub-Registrar, Ambala City, purporting to act as Sub-Registrar, Ambala Cantonment, during the period commencement on the 6th January, 1955, and ending with 17th August, 1955; shall be deemed to have been validly performed as if the aforesaid persons had been duly appointed as Registrars or Sub-Registrars, as the case may be, under the Indian Registration Act, 1908 (Central Act XVI of 1908), for the purposes of the performance of such acts.
The Schedule
District | Registering Officer | Period |
Rohtak | (i) Treasury Officer | 29th October, 1954, to 4th January, 1956 |
(ii) General Assistant | 5th January, 1956, to 31st July, 1956 | |
Ambala | (i) General Assistant | 30th December, 1955, to 11th January, 1956 |
(ii) General Assistant | 13th January, 1956, to 11th August, 1956 | |
Hoshiarpur | (i) Treasury Officer | 22nd February, 1929, to 23rd December, 1955. |
(ii) General Assistant | 19th January, 1956, to 9th April, 1956 | |
Gurdaspur | (i) Treasury Officer | 8th May, 1924, to 31st December, 1956. |
Amritsar | (i) Treasury Officer | 15th August, 1947, to 15th January, 1956 |
(ii) General Assistant | 16th January, 1956, to 31st December, 1956 |
